Soy Wax Vs. Paraffin Wax



When contrasting soy wax and paraffin wax for candle making, it is vital to recognize the distinct attributes and benefits of each material. Soy wax is an all-natural, renewable source stemmed from soybean oil, making it environment-friendly and biodegradable - home fragrance. In contrast, paraffin wax is a by-product of petroleum refining, which elevates issues regarding its ecological impact and sustainability


Soy wax candles melt cleaner and give off less residue compared to paraffin wax candle lights, making them a healthier selection for indoor air quality. In addition, soy wax has a reduced melting factor, permitting a longer-lasting candle light that disperses scent a lot more successfully. Paraffin wax, on the various other hand, often tends to shed faster and less cleanly, possibly releasing damaging chemicals into the air.


From a sustainability perspective, soy wax is favored for its biodegradability and eco-friendly sourcing, straightening with the expanding customer choice for eco conscious products. While paraffin wax has actually been a standard selection in candle making as a result of its price and simplicity of usage, the change in the direction of environmentally friendly alternatives like soy wax is acquiring momentum in the market.

Recycling and Disposal Factors To Consider



Reusing and appropriate disposal of soy wax candles play a vital role in preserving ecological sustainability and decreasing waste in neighborhoods and families. When it comes to reusing soy wax candle lights, the initial step is to guarantee that the candle light has shed entirely.

To recycle the soy wax, it is necessary to separate any wick remnants or debris from the wax. This can be done by delicately removing any leftover wick or utilizing a great mesh strainer to filter out any pollutants. The tidy wax can then be repurposed right into brand-new candles or used for various other do it yourself projects.


In regards to disposal, if recycling is not an option, soy wax candle lights are eco-friendly and can be safely disposed of in a lot of home waste systems. It is always advised to examine with neighborhood reusing centers or waste management solutions for certain standards on candle light disposal to make certain appropriate handling and ecological defense.
